This week’s Around Town has some family friendly events talking place, even some for our furry friends.

The Michigan Humane Society’s 13th annual Mega March is a three-day family fun event.

On Friday evening, from 5 p.m. to 9 p.m., bring your dogs to Batch Brewing in Corktown.

There you can register for one of the walks this weekend and drink a grapefruit IPA, $2 from every pint will benefit the organization.

Then Saturday, head to Kensington Metropark in Milford for the walk that starts at 10 a.m.

Sunday, you can go to the Detroit Riverwalk's Cullen Plaza for the second walk, also starting at 10 a.m.

It doesn’t take much to participate.

“There is no registration fee and T-shirts are included when you register for the Mega March this time around, so we are encouraging folks to fundraise, but if you just want to come hang out and make a small donation on your own, you are more than welcome to do so,” said Anna Chrisman of the Michigan Humane Society.
